Replacing strsav() with the safer string_append() or string_join().
[privoxy.git] / README
diff --git a/README b/README
index 3d526ba..ab199e0 100644 (file)
--- a/README
+++ b/README
@@ -36,29 +36,40 @@ which will eventually become Junkbuster v3.0. See
 http://ijbswa.sourceforge.net.\r
 \r
 Internet Junkbuster is a web proxy with advanced filtering\r
-capabilities for protecting privacy and removing ads, banners, pop-ups\r
-and other obnoxious Internet Junk.\r
-\r
+capabilities for protecting privacy, filtering web page content,\r
+managing cookies, controlling access, and removing ads, banners,\r
+pop-ups and other obnoxious Internet Junk. Junkbuster has a very\r
+flexible configuration and can be customized to suit individual needs\r
+and tastes. Internet Junkbuster has application for both stand-alone\r
+systems and multi-user networks.\r
+\r
+JunkBuster was originally written by JunkBusters Corporation, and was\r
+released as free open-source software under the GNU GPL. Stefan\r
+Waldherr made many improvements, and started the SourceForge project\r
+to continue development.\r
 \r
  INSTALL\r
 --------\r
 \r
 For tarball, first unpack:\r
 \r
- tar zxvf ijb_source_*\r
- cd ijb_source_2.9.9_alpha\r
+ tar xzvf ijb_source_* [.tgz or .tar.gz]\r
+ cd ijb_source_2.9.10_alpha\r
 \r
- ./configure\r
- make\r
- su\r
- make install\r
+ autoheader   [suggested for CVS source]\r
+ autoconf     [suggested for CVS source]\r
+ ./configure   (--help to see options)\r
+ gmake         (the make from gnu) \r
+ su \r
+ make -n install       (to see where all the files will go)\r
+ make install          (to really install)\r
 \r
 Redhat and SuSE src and binary RPMs can be built with 'make\r
 redhat-dist' or 'make suse-dist' (run ./configure first). BSD\r
-will (probably) require gmake (from http://gnu.org). See the \r
+will (probably?) require gmake (from http://gnu.org). See the \r
 user-manual for OS/2 build instructions.\r
 \r
-Junkbuster is also availabe via anonymous CVS:\r
+Junkbuster is also available via anonymous CVS:\r
 \r
  cvs -d:pserver:anonymous@cvs.ijbswa.sourceforge.net:/cvsroot/ijbswa login\r
  cvs -z3 -d:pserver:anonymous@cvs.ijbswa.sourceforge.net:/cvsroot/ijbswa co current\r
@@ -70,25 +81,37 @@ build as above.
  RUN\r
 ----\r
 \r
- junkbuster /etc/junkbuster/config &\r
+ junkbuster /etc/junkbuster/config \r
 \r
-Or for RPMS: /etc/rc.d/init.d/junkbuster start\r
+Or for RedHat: /etc/rc.d/init.d/junkbuster start\r
+Or for SuSE:   /etc/rc.d/junkbuster start\r
 \r
 The only command line option supported is the location of the \r
 main configuration file. If none is specified, Junkbuster will \r
-look for a file named 'config' in the current directory.\r
+look for a file named 'config' for unix, config.txt for Win32 \r
+in the current directory.\r
+\r
 \r
+ CONFIGURATION\r
+--------------\r
 \r
-CONFIGURATION\r
--------------\r
+See: 'config', 'ijb.action', and 're_filterfile'. These are all well\r
+commented. On Unix-like systems, these files are installed in /etc/junkbuster.\r
+On Windows, then wherever the executable itself is installed. There are many\r
+significant changes and advances since v2.0.x. The user-manual has a \r
+run down of configuration options, and examples: \r
+http://ijbswa.sourceforge.net/user-manual/.\r
 \r
-See: 'config', 'actionsfile', and 're_filterfile'. These are all well\r
-commented. There are many changes and advances since v2.0.x. Be sure to set\r
-your browsers for HTTP/HTTPS Proxy at localhost:8000.\r
+Be sure to set your browser(s) for HTTP/HTTPS Proxy at <IP>:<Port>,\r
+or whatever you specify in the config file under 'listen-address'.\r
+DEFAULT is localhost:8000.\r
 \r
+The ijb.action file can be configured via the web interface accessed via\r
+http://i.j.b/, as well other options.\r
 \r
-DOCUMENTATION\r
--------------\r
+\r
+ DOCUMENTATION\r
+--------------\r
 \r
 The best source of information on the current development version, is\r
 either comments in the source code, or the included configuration\r
@@ -97,15 +120,15 @@ files, which are all well commented. These are 'config',
 \r
 There is a growing amount of new documentation in the 'doc'\r
 subdirectory, but it is sparse at this point. In particular, see \r
-the user-manual there.\r
+the user-manual there, which is 'nearly there'.\r
 \r
 Some legacy documentation is also included only to give an idea of\r
 what Junkbuster can do under doc/obsolete/*. Much has changed since\r
 these docs were written, so beware.\r
 \r
 \r
-BUGS\r
-----\r
+ BUGS\r
+-----\r
 \r
 Use the form at\r
 http://sourceforge.net/tracker/index.php?group_id=11118&atid=111118 to\r
@@ -115,4 +138,4 @@ anything new.
 -------------------------------------------------------------------------\r
 ijbswa-developers@lists.sourceforge.net\r
 \r
-$Id: README,v 1.2 2001/09/14 21:28:12 hal9 Exp $\r
+$Id: README,v 1.8 2001/11/05 21:54:48 steudten Exp $\r